Manor View Court is in Worthing and in Worthing district. BN14 8HB is located in the Gaisford elect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of East Worthing and Shoreham.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

Is Manor View Court Street dangerous?

In 2023, 377 crimes were reported near Manor View Court . Only 27% of streets in the UK are more dangerous. This street can be considered not safe. The most common type of crime was shoplifting. Crime rate was measured within a 0.5 mile radius of BN14 8HB.

BN14 8HB area has a high level of entrepreneurship. Only 18% of streets have higher percent of entrepreneur residents. 13% of population in this area is self-employed, while the average in the UK is 9.7%. High number of entrepreneurs usually leads to relatively high economic growth, higher paid jobs and better quality of life in the area.
